Lime shrimp tacos are a perfect summery dish with a lot of flavors you'll love! It can be be low fat if you use little oil or butter. You can also add cheese and sour cream, if you like.
Ingredients
- 1 pound cooked small shrimp
- 1 tablespoon olive oil , or to taste
- 3 cloves garlic , minced
- salt to taste
Instructions
-
1
Combine shrimp, olive oil, garlic, and salt in a bowl. Let sit while you prepare the salsa.
-
2
Combine tomatoes, mango, avocado, bell pepper, 3 tablespoons lime juice, chile pepper, and sugar in a bowl. Mix until salsa is evenly combined.
-
3
Heat a large skillet over medium heat. Add shrimp; cook and stir until moisture evaporates, 3 to 5 minutes. Stir in cilantro, tequila, and 3 tablespoons lime juice.
-
4
Serve hot shrimp and salsa over corn tortillas.
